数字钱包app_数字货币交易app官方下载最新版/苹果版/安卓版
<font dir="wqx"></font><noscript dir="dq6"></noscript><small lang="c9a"></small><dfn id="8af"></dfn>

区块链数字货币钱包App系统开发全景:从社交到实时支付管理

区块链数字货币钱包App的系统开发,需要同时覆盖“链上资产能力、链下交互体验、安全合规风控、交易与支付效率、运营与增长闭环”。下面围绕你给出的八个模块,系统性探讨其产品逻辑、关键功能、数据与接口设计要点、以及从工程角度落地的实现策略。

一、社交钱包:把“资产管理”与“社交信任”联动

1)核心价值

- 让用户通过联系人、群组、好友圈完成更低摩擦的转账、分账、红包、投票/协作支付。

- 将“社交关系”映射到链上行为(地址/标签/会话)与链下身份(联系人、头像、实名状态)。

2)关键功能

- 好友/联系人发现:支持手机号、邮箱、社交账号绑定、地址簿/二维码。

- 社交收款:生成“会话收款码”,群内成员无需逐一复制地址。

- 分账/账单:按人均摊、比例分摊、指定金额;支持账单结算后自动对账。

- 红包/抽奖:支持随机金额或固定金额;需处理领取、超时、退款与链上状态一致性。

3)数据与接口要点

- 地址与身份映射表:user_id ↔ wallet_address ↔ alias。

- 会话/账单状态机:创建→待支付→部分完成→完成→结算/关闭。

- 链上事件监听:交易确认、失败、回滚(取决于链特性)。

- 隐私与权限:社交可见性https://www.pddnb1.com ,(仅好友可见、仅群可见、匿名模式)。

二、行情提醒:让交易决策更及时

1)核心价值

- 降低用户盯盘成本,提高触发式交易与资产管理效率。

2)关键功能

- 价格阈值提醒:到达目标价格/跌破/涨幅区间。

- 资产组合提醒:组合净值、某币种权重变化提醒。

- 技术指标/事件提醒(可选):如成交量异常、24h涨跌、资金费率(衍生品场景)。

- 个性化策略:移动端规则引擎(用户配置后下发任务)。

3)工程落地建议

- 行情数据源:交易所API/聚合行情服务/自建撮合聚合。

- 推送通道:APNs/FCM/站内通知;结合节流与合并通知。

- 定时与事件:轮询+订阅混合;保证在高峰时段仍可承载。

- 容错:行情延迟标记、区间触发的“幂等”处理与去重。

三、市场调查:为产品与运营提供“可量化答案”

1)核心目标

- 通过数据洞察理解:用户为什么来、为什么不留、哪里流失、哪类功能最能驱动转化。

2)常见调查维度

- 需求侧:用户画像、持币偏好、风险偏好、使用场景(交易/储值/支付)。

- 使用侧:功能留存、关键路径(注册→导入钱包→充值/转账→使用支付→留存)。

- 供给侧:币种覆盖、网络稳定性、手续费体验。

- 合规侧:不同地区监管差异导致的功能差异(可用币种/上架审批)。

3)实现方式

- 事件埋点体系:统一事件命名、参数规范(币种、网络、渠道、是否首次)。

- A/B测试:对提醒策略、支付入口、确认页展示进行实验。

- 用户反馈闭环:工单、问卷、客服会话归档;与故障与版本关联。

- 数据看板:留存漏斗、支付成功率、链上确认耗时分布。

四、便捷资金存取:让充值/提现“低摩擦可追踪”

1)核心价值

- 存取速度、费用透明、状态可追踪是钱包的基本体验。

2)关键功能

- 充值:生成地址/二维码、支持多网络(ERC20/BSC/TRC20等)、自动识别到账。

- 提现:费用估算、最小提币限制、风控校验(黑名单地址/异常行为)。

- 交易记录:按时间线展示、展示区块高度/确认数/失败原因。

- 地址簿管理:常用收款地址、标签、备注。

3)工程要点

- 资产归集/UTXO模型差异:不同链处理方式不同(UTXO vs 账户模型)。

- 余额计算:链上余额+待确认余额+本地锁定余额。

- 状态一致性:提交交易→待签名→待广播→待确认→完成/失败。

- 手续费策略:推荐Gas/动态费率;支持用户自定义但需风险提示。

五、便捷市场管理:把“币种/行情/持仓”组织成可管理资产台账

1)核心价值

- 用户不只看“价格”,还需要“持仓结构、成本、收益、再平衡”。

2)关键功能

- 自选/关注列表:按偏好排序、置顶常用币种。

- 持仓管理:总资产、分类资产、平均成本、盈亏统计。

- 成本与流水:支持导入交易记录/手工纠正成本(可选)。

- 资产再平衡(可选):建议换仓/提醒阈值。

3)接口与数据结构

- 资产视图模型:symbol、network、balance、locked、unconfirmed。

- 币种元数据:价格精度、最小交易单位、合约地址、风险提示。

- 性能:持仓列表分页、缓存策略与刷新节流。

六、便捷支付:把钱包能力变成“可用的交易入口”

1)核心价值

- 支付场景需要“短路径”和“高成功率”,尤其是商户/线下场景。

2)关键功能

- 收款:二维码/收款码、金额与备注、倒计时与过期策略。

- 付款:从订单/商户页发起转账,自动填充币种与网络。

- 支付状态回传:链上确认后回调商户系统。

- 支付安全:签名授权、额度限制、风险评分。

3)工程落地

- 商户API:订单创建、支付状态查询、回调签名验证。

- 前后端一致性:支付页展示状态必须与链上事件对齐。

- 多链多代币:统一“支付抽象层”(PaymentService)屏蔽链差异。

七、实时支付管理:从“发起支付”到“可运营的支付生命周期”

1)核心价值

- 实时性与可控性:失败重试、超时退款、对账与审计。

2)关键能力

- 支付订单状态机

- 已创建→已提交→待确认→已完成→已超时/失败→已退款/撤销(依链与合约能力决定)。

- 实时推送与轮询兜底

- Webhook回调给商户;App端使用订阅/轮询刷新。

- 风控与异常处理

- 重放攻击防护、签名校验、地址风险、链拥堵提示。

- 对账与审计

- 订单金额、实际链上到账、手续费、确认数与时间差。

3)实现要点

- 幂等性:同一订单多次回调不导致重复记账。

- 事件驱动:链上事件→订单聚合→通知与回调。

- 监控告警:交易广播失败率、确认超时率、回调失败率。

八、贯穿全局的系统架构建议(安全、合规、体验与可观测性)

1)安全

- 密钥管理:本地安全存储/硬件钱包支持(可选)、加密与权限隔离。

- 防篡改:交易签名过程防调试、反外挂(视平台而定)。

- 风控:地址信誉、异常频率、金额偏离、跨链风险评估。

2)合规与合规化产品设计

- KYC/AML流程(如适用):限制高风险操作、分级权限。

- 资产与功能披露:风险提示、不可逆交易告知。

- 数据留存:审计日志与用户授权记录。

3)体验

- 关键路径优化:注册/导入→备份提示→首笔转账→首次支付完成。

- 状态可视化:所有资金变化必须可追踪、可解释。

- 性能与稳定性:缓存、分页、降级(行情/通知服务不可用时不影响链上基础操作)。

4)可观测性

- 指标体系:成功率、平均确认耗时、通知延迟、回调成功率。

- 日志追踪:链上TxHash与订单号全链路关联。

- 故障演练:断网、行情源失效、链拥堵、回调延迟等。

结语

综合来看,区块链数字货币钱包App系统开发不是单点功能拼装,而是围绕“链上状态一致性+链下体验效率+安全合规风控+实时可运营能力”构建端到端闭环。社交钱包增强传播与使用粘性;行情提醒与市场调查提升决策与运营效率;便捷资金存取与便捷市场管理保证资产可控;便捷支付与实时支付管理则把钱包能力转化为真实交易价值。下一步建议你明确目标链/目标商户模式/合规要求与团队技术栈,我可以进一步给出模块级系统架构图、数据库表设计要点与接口清单。

作者:林澈 发布时间:2026-06-23 00:46:12

相关阅读